Felissa
feh-LISS-ah
Felissa is a girl’s name of Latin origin, meaning “A variant of Felicia, derived from the Latin 'felix,' meaning 'lucky' or 'happy'.”, and peaked in popularity in 1970.
What Felissa Means
“A variant of Felicia, derived from the Latin 'felix,' meaning 'lucky' or 'happy'.”
The Story of Felissa
This name carries an ancient blessing of luck and happiness, a sound that feels like a warm embrace.
Felissa is a flowing variant of Felicia, directly from the Latin 'felix,' meaning 'lucky' or 'happy.' It gained popularity in the mid-20th century, a name chosen to invoke cheerfulness and a favorable path.
